Barro's Pizza
Public records show eight inspections at Barro's Pizza stretching back to 2024. On Jan 12, 2026, the health department conducted the most recent visit. Low risk means the most recent visit produced few or no significant findings.
Recent inspections have turned up roughly the same number of issues each time, hovering near zero violations per visit.
When inspectors have written things up, “backflow prevention, air gap” has been the most frequent reason, cited two times.
Barro's Pizza's latest score of 100 sits above the Chandler average of 95. The file should reassure diners considering a visit.
